Gallery 3.0+ (development version) ABOUT: Gallery 3 is a web based software product that lets you manage your photos on your own website. You must have your own website with PHP and database support in order to install and use it. With Gallery you can easily create and share albums of photos via an intuitive interface. INTENDED AUDIENCE: This version is intended for anybody who has a website. We stand ready to support the product and help you to make the most of it. We welcome theme and module developers to play with this release and start turning out slick new designs for our happy users. SUPPORTED CONFIGURATION: - Platform: Linux / Unix. - Web server: Apache 2.2 and newer. - PHP 5.2.3 and newer (PHP's safe_mode must be disabled and simplexml, filter, and json must be installed). - Database: MySQL 5 and newer. For complete system requirements, please refer to: http://codex.galleryproject.org/Gallery3:Requirements INSTALLING AND UPGRADING INSTRUCTIONS: For comprehensive instructions, The online User Guide is your best resource: http://codex.galleryproject.org/Gallery3:User_guide There are also simple instructions below. NOTE: You can upgrade from beta 1 and beyond, but not from alpha releases. INSTALLATION VIA THE WEB: - Point your web browser at gallery3/installer/ and follow the instructions. INSTALLATION FROM THE COMMAND LINE: - php installer/index.php [-h host] [-u user] [-p pass] [-d dbname] Command line parameters: -h Database host (default: localhost) -u Database user (default: root) -p Database user password (default: ) -d Database name (default: gallery3) -x Table prefix (default: ) BUGS?
